Close Pension Pot to settle debts and migrate

I have a small pension fund that has been left idle for a long time now, largely due to having a pensions elsewhere.


This pot in question is only £13.5k and held with Virgin money.
currently planning to migrate to Vietnam in the coming months.. and would like to settle debts before I go. Currently 48 years old..


any suggestions or options anyone can think of ?

    +1. Until you are 55 the money might as well not exist. You can't withdraw it, v you can't borrow against it,* you can't benefit from it in any way, unless are terminally ill.

    Various outfits at various times have claimed to offer punters a way of getting at their pensions before the usual age under the guise of pension liberation. The schemes they offered were nearly all scams and the most likely outcome was that they would scarper with your money, leaving you with no pension AND a hefty tax bill for the unauthorised withdrawal.

    *You can of course take out a common or garden loan with the intention of using your pension to pay the loan of when you turn 55, but you can't use your pension as security to get a better interest rate or make yourself more creditworthy. And if course that wouldn't really fit in with the idea of settling debts anyway.
